How do Hampstead Academy students fare in academic competition?
We are very involved in “Destination Imagination”, an international competition that promotes creative/cooperative problem solving skills. Each year, we have between 5 and 8 teams competing. Our students have consistently won Regional and State championships to proceed to World Finals eleven times in the past years. Of particular pride (on eight occasions) our teams received the “DaVinci” award given for outstanding creativity, as well as five “Renaissance” awards for outstanding skill in engineering, design and performance. Many of our Upper school students were invited this year to participate in the John Hopkins University Center for Talented Youth (CTY) program based on exceptional mathematical and/or verbal reasoning abilities as measured by national achievement test scores of 95% and above.
